Scripps partners with AdPlay for new ad platform

In a move to  simplify and better integrate the print and online marketplace, E.W. Scripps Company will adopt a new print and online classified ad platform, thanks to its partnership with online classified ad company AdPay, Media Week reported Thursday.

The AdPay network offers classified and display ads integrated with retail inventory as well as Web-to-Web, Web-to-print and print-to-Web capabilities, said Rusty Coats, vice president of interactive for Scripps.

By June 1, Scripps expects 19 of its newspapers to be on the AdPay platform. The sites will aggregate searches of content from other sites as well as combine the order-entry system for both print and online ads, Media Week reported. Ad placement will also be facilitated by the fact that they can simultaneously be added to the Web site, newspaper and AdPay's national classified network.
